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Plan treatment to residents and patients with temporary or long term disabilities to relieve pain, restore or improve function, and promote healing
Assure all treatment is delivered in accordance with an established plan of care
Provide clinical support and instruct patients, families, and caregivers
Monitor patient response to treatment intervention
Complete required forms and documentation in accordance with company policy and state/federal regulations
Consulting with patients to learn about their physical condition
Assessing and interpreting patient evaluations and test results
Developing treatment plans using a variety of treatment techniques
Creating personalized fitness‑oriented health care programs for patients
Administering medically prescribed physical therapy treatments to relieve pain and improve mobility
Advising patients on exercise techniques
Advising patients and their families about in‑home treatment options
Providing educational information about injury prevention, ergonomics and ways to promote physical health
Consulting and collaborating with other healthcare professionals
Documenting patient care history
Complying with rules, regulations, and procedures
